Introduction

A flaring machine is an essential tool for professionals working with pipes and tubing, especially in plumbing and HVAC systems. This device is designed to create a flared end on pipes, which is crucial for making secure, leak-proof connections. When using a flaring machine, it's important to choose the right size and type for your specific needs.

Flaring machines are commonly used in various applications, including:
  • Plumbing installations
  • HVAC system setups
  • Automotive repair tasks

The process of flaring involves expanding the end of a pipe to form a specific angle, typically 45 degrees, which allows for a tight fit with other components. This is particularly important in high-pressure systems where leaks can lead to significant issues.

When selecting a flaring machine, consider the following factors:
  • Material compatibility: Ensure the machine can handle the type of pipe you are working with.
  • Size range: Choose a machine that accommodates the sizes of pipes you frequently use.
  • Ease of use: Look for features that enhance usability, such as ergonomic handles and clear markings.

FAQs

How can I choose the best flaring machine for my needs?

Consider the types of materials you will be working with, the sizes of pipes you need to flare, and the frequency of use. Look for a machine that offers durability and ease of operation.

What are the key features to look for when selecting a flaring machine?

Key features include compatibility with various pipe materials, size versatility, ease of use, and ergonomic design for comfortable handling.

Are there any common mistakes people make when purchasing a flaring machine?

Common mistakes include not considering the size range needed, purchasing a machine that isn't compatible with the materials being used, and overlooking user reviews.

Can I use a flaring machine for both copper and aluminum pipes?

Yes, many flaring machines are designed to work with both copper and aluminum pipes, but always check the specifications of the machine to ensure compatibility.

How do I maintain my flaring machine?

Regularly clean the machine after use, check for any wear on the components, and lubricate moving parts as needed to ensure longevity and optimal performance.
